Charles Huston Bankston

Funeral for "C.H." Charles Huston Bankston, 85, of Marietta, Ga., will be today, Oct. 28, 2006, at 2 p.m. at Parkway Funeral Home with Jerry Accettura officiating.
Burial will be in East Lawrence Memorial Gardens.

Mr. Bankston, who died Thursday, Oct. 26, 2006, was born Feb. 9, 1921, in Decatur to Gaines Harrison Bankston and Belle Bankston. He was a World War II veteran and was a retired Lockheed Aircraft Electrical Inspector. Mr. Bankston was a missionary to Zimbabwe, Africa, in the 1950's. He was also instrumental in establishing several churchs in Alabama and Georgia, including Powers Ferry Road Church of Christ in Marietta, Ga., where he was a member for the past 40 years. Two brothers, Clyde Bankston and Allen Bankston, and one sister, Rosie Burden, preceded him in death.

Survivors include his wife, Sara Jane Bankston; one son, C. Harrison Bankston and wife Carol, of Huntsville; one sister, Mary Ellen Sparks; two grandchildren, Karon Michele Baerlin and husband Mike, and Cheryl Dawn Alexander and husband Lane; and 14 great-grandchildren.
Pallbearers will be Mark Moody, Jackson Waters Jr., Chase Baerlin, Billy Gene Bankston, Danny Moody, Guinn Sparks, Nathan Harrison and Tommy Moody.

Memorials may be made to the American Cancer Society. Published in the Decatur Daily on October 28, 2006
